Abstract

Purpose

This paper aims to reveal the influencing mechanism of the interaction between institutional environments in the home and host country on the accelerated internationalization of entrepreneurial enterprises from emerging economies (EE). The authors want to open the black box of home-country institutional environments’ moderating mechanism on the relationship between host-country institutional environments and accelerated internationalization.

Design/methodology/approach

The authors chose a massive interview method and case study method to answer this question. According to our standards, the authors chose four high-tech companies in Guangdong and Guangxi provinces as case study samples. During investigation in the four case companies, the authors collected print data of 150 pages and electric data of 3 pages. Then, the authors excavated concepts in data through open coding, axial coding and select-type coding and identified concepts’ dimensions and connections between them.

Findings

Well-developed home-country institutions can reduce the inhibitory effect of under-developed host-country institutions on the accelerated internationalization of entrepreneurial enterprises from emerging economies. Under-developed institutional environments in the home country are beneficial for entrepreneurial enterprises from EE to develop the institutional capability for entrepreneurial enterprises with stronger institutional capability from emerging economies. The inhibitory effect of under-developed institutional environments in the host country on their accelerated internationalization is weaker. The positive moderating role played by institutional voids in the home country on the relationship between institutional voids in the host country and the accelerated internationalization are mediated by the institutional capability of entrepreneurial enterprises from emerging economies.

Research limitations/implications

The authors just refined the definition of institutional capability and divided its dimensions. Issues such as operationalization of institutional capability and the development of measurement scale are also worthy for future quantitative research. Considering the inherent defect of case study and that these four case companies are from Chinese high-tech industry, the external validity our research may be limited. The theoretical model that was constructed generally captured the relationships between dual institutional environments, institutional capability and EE entrepreneurial firms’ accelerated internationalization decision. Future studies may use a large-scale sample to verify the all propositions the authors introduced to draw more steady and reliable empirical study results.

Practical implications

The conclusions have significant implications for governments in EE to construct friendly institutional environments for international entrepreneurship and for entrepreneurial firms to implement internationalization strategies.

Social implications

Policy makers should establish well-developed normative and cognitive institutional environment by cultivating global-orientated and open national culture and organizing experience exchange conference, thereby speeding up the implementation of internationalization strategies and further improving international competitiveness for a country.

Originality/value

First, the authors defined institutional capability as firms’ ability of establishing relationships with institution actors, adapting to institutional contexts, changing existing institutions or creating new ones to gain potential interests and suggested that it consists of three dimensions. Second, institutional voids in the home country positively moderate the relationship between under-developed institutional environments in the host country and the accelerated internationalization of entrepreneurial firms from EE. At last, institutional capability of firms negatively moderates the relationship between under-developed institutional environments in the host country and the accelerated internationalization of entrepreneurial firms from EE.

Abstract

Purpose

This study aimed to investigate the collective effects of bending load and hygrothermal aging on glass fibre-reinforced plastics (GFRP) due to the fact that stress and water absorption is inevitable during GFRP applications.

Design/methodology/approach

The water boiling method was used to study the moisture absorption, desorption behaviour and evaluate the performance of GFRP laminates under loading in this article. The moisture diffusion of laminates is characterized in three aging conditions (25°C, 45°C and 65°C water), along with three levels of bending load coefficients (0, 0.3 and 0.6). The moisture diffusion coefficients are determined through the curve fitting method of the experimental data of the initial process, based on the Fickian diffusion model. Moreover, the laminates’ performance is further discussed after adequate environmental aging and loading.

Findings

It was found that moisture absorption is promoted by the presence of bending load and boiling during this study. The absorption diffusion coefficient and moisture equilibrium content of the specimens increased with an increasing loading ratio and temperature. The bending strength of the laminate varied according to a contrary trend. Furthermore, the desorbed moisture content is found to be much higher after higher levels of bending load because it is harder to desorb the moisture in the interfaces and micro cracks.

Research limitations/implications

Collective effects of bending load and hygrothermal aging promote the absorption and result in accelerating property degradation of GFRP. It is significant to focus on these effects on the failure of GFRP.

Originality/value

A novel unit was designed to simulate the various loading acted on containers in this work.

Abstract

Purpose

Despite the fact that user participation (UP) has been highlighted as an important aspect in innovation, previous findings on its relationship with service innovation performance (SIP) are inconsistent. This study aims to investigate the relationships among UP, knowledge management capability (KMC) and SIP, especially in the digital age, inspired by the theories of knowledge-based and absorptive capacity.

Design/methodology/approach

Based on a sample of 252 Chinese e-commerce enterprises, this study adopts a hierarchical regression analysis and bootstrap method to test the theoretical framework and research hypotheses.

Findings

UP and KMC have positive effects on SIP, respectively. KMC plays a mediating role in the effect of UP on SIP. Furthermore, the intermediary role of KMC varies in different sub-paths between UP and SIP.

Originality/value

First, this study provides some explanations for inconsistent arguments on the relationship between UP and service innovation. Second, with the consideration of specific dimensions of UP and SIP, the mediation role of KMC varies in different sub-paths has been recognized, which provides a deeper understanding of the relationship between UP and SIP. Third, this study opens the discussion about how to realize SIP more effectively in the digital age, advancing theoretical and practical developments on service innovation.

Abstract

Purpose

The purpose of this paper is to study the tribological properties of Cu nanoparticles (NPs) as lubricant additives in three kinds of commercially available lubricants.

Design/methodology/approach

A four-ball machine is used to estimate the tribological properties of Cu NPs as lubricant additives in three kinds of commercially available lubricants. Three-dimensional optical profiler and electrical contact resistance are evaluated to investigate the morphology of the worn surfaces and the influence of Cu NPs on tribofilms.

Findings

Wear tests show that the addition of Cu NPs as lubricant additives could reduce wear and increase load-carrying capacity of commercially available lubricants remarkably, indicating that Cu NPs have a good compatibility with the existing lubricant additives in commercially available lubricants.

Originality/value

The tribological properties of Cu NPs as lubricant additives in three kinds of commercially available lubricants were investigated in this paper. These results are reliable and can be very helpful for application of Cu NPs as lubricant additives in industry.

Abstract

Purpose

This study investigates the influence of social trust on the attainment of corporate environmental, social and governance (ESG) objectives.

Design/methodology/approach

This study conducts panel regression analysis on a distinctive dataset for 2009–2017 on Chinese firms.

Findings

The analysis reveals a significant positive association between social trust and firm-level ESG practices. Moreover, the impact of social trust on shaping ESG outcomes is further amplified by factors such as economic growth, corporate governance standards and institutional quality. This relationship remains statistically positive when the authors employ alternative measures and methodologies, such as the instrumental variables, propensity score matching and difference-in-differences approaches. Notably, the results of heterogeneity tests indicate that the Trust–ESG nexus is more prominent for state-owned enterprises and firms with substantial market capitalization, superior profitability and higher leverage.

Originality/value

This study expands the comprehension of the determinants of ESG and underscores the influential role of social trust as an informal institution in enhancing a firm's ESG performance.

Abstract

Purpose

Internet marketing underground industry users refer to people who use technology means to simulate a large number of real consumer behaviors to obtain marketing activities rewards illegally, which leads to increased cost of enterprises and reduced effect of marketing. Therefore, this paper aims to construct a user risk assessment model to identify potential underground industry users to protect the interests of real consumers and reduce the marketing costs of enterprises.

Design/methodology/approach

Method feature extraction is based on two aspects. The first aspect is based on traditional statistical characteristics, using density-based spatial clustering of applications with noise clustering method to obtain user-dense regions. According to the total number of users in the region, the corresponding risk level of the receiving address is assigned. So that high-quality address information can be extracted. The second aspect is based on the time period during which users participate in activities, using frequent item set mining to find multiple users with similar operations within the same time period. Extract the behavior flow chart according to the user participation, so that the model can mine the deep relationship between the participating behavior and the underground industry users.

Findings

Based on the real underground industry user data set, the features of the data set are extracted by the proposed method. The features are experimentally verified by different models such as random forest, fully-connected layer network, SVM and XGBOST, and the proposed method is comprehensively evaluated. Experimental results show that in the best case, our method can improve the F1-score of traditional models by 55.37%.

Originality/value

This paper investigates the relative importance of static information and dynamic behavior characteristics of users in predicting underground industry users, and whether the absence of features of these categories affects the prediction results. This investigation can go a long way in aiding further research on this subject and found the features which improved the accuracy of predicting underground industry users.

Abstract

Purpose

The purpose of this paper is to demonstrate visually the knowledge structure and evolution of disruptive innovation. The paper used CiteSpace III to analyze 1,570 disruptive innovation records from the Web of Science database between 1997 and 2016.

Design/methodology/approach

Initially, this paper offers a comprehensive overview of papers, countries, journals, scholars and application areas. Subsequently, a time zone view of high-frequency keywords is presented, emphasizing the course of evolution of the study hotspots. Finally, a visualization map of cited references and co-citation analysis are provided to detect the knowledge base at the forefront of disruptive innovation.

Findings

The findings are as follows: the number of papers shows exponential growth. The USA has the largest contribution and the strongest center. The Netherlands shows the largest burst, followed by Japan. Journal of Production Innovation Management and Research Policy is the most important journals. Hang CC has the largest number of articles. Walsh ST is identified as a high-yielding scholar. Christensen CM is the most authoritative scholar. Engineering electrical electronic is the most widely used research category, followed by management and business. The evolutionary course of the study hotspots is divided into five stages, namely, start, burst, aggregation, dispersion and not yet formed. Eight key streams in the literature are extracted to summarize the knowledge base at the forefront of disruptive innovation.

Originality/value

This paper explores the whole picture of disruptive innovation research and demonstrates a visual knowledge structure and the evolution of disruptive innovation. It provides an important reference for scholars to capture the current situation and influential trends in this field.

Abstract

Purpose

Due to the inability to directly apply an intra-oral image with esthetic restoration to restore tooth shape in the computer-aided design system, this paper aims to propose a method that can use two-dimensional contours obtained from the image for the three-dimensional dental mesh model restoration.

Design/methodology/approach

First, intra-oral image and smiling image are taken from the patient, then teeth shapes of the images are designed based on esthetic restoration concepts and the pixel coordinates of the teeth’s contours are converted into the vertex coordinates in the three-dimensional space. Second, the dental mesh model is divided into three parts – active part, passive part and fixed part – based on the teeth’s contours of the mesh model. Third, the vertices from the teeth’s contours of the dental model are matched with ones from the intra-oral image and with the help of matching operation, the target coordinates of each vertex in the active part can be calculated. Finally, the Laplacian-based deformation algorithm and mesh smoothing algorithm are performed.

Findings

Benefitting from the proposed method, the dental mesh model with esthetic restoration can be quickly obtained based on the intra-oral image that is the result of doctor-patient communication. Experimental results show that the quality of restoration meets clinical needs, and the typical time cost of the method is approximately one second. So the method is both time-saving and user-friendly.

Originality/value

The method provides the possibility to design personalized dental esthetic restoration solutions rapidly.

Abstract

Purpose

The purpose of this paper is to develop the efficiency of styrene-acrylate (SA) emulsions for polymer cement waterproof coatings with improved bacteria resistance and mechanical properties.

Design/methodology/approach

For effective bacteria resistance and excellent mechanical properties, various concentrations of methacryloxyethylhexadecyl dimethylammonium bromide (MHDB) were synthesised and incorporated into SA emulsions. The properties of SA emulsions modified with MHDB were characterised and compared with those of unmodified ones according to the formulations of polymer cement waterproof coatings.

Findings

The SA emulsions modified with MHDB exhibited significant enhancement of bacteria resistance and mechanical properties over the unmodified ones. The positive quaternary nitrogen and long-chain alkyl groups of MHDB in SA emulsions could attract phospholipid head groups of bacterial and insert them into the cell wall, which results in biomass leak and bactericidal effect. Moreover, MHDB as a softened monomer was beneficial to the synthesis of SA copolymer with low glass-transition temperature (Tg), then the copolymer and cement would form a more compact film which was the main reason for the enhancement of mechanical properties.

Research limitations/implications

The modifier MHDB was synthesised from diethylaminoethyl methacrylate (DEAM) and 1-bromohexadecane. Besides, the congeners of MHDB could be synthesised from DEAM and 1-bromododecane, 1-tetradecyl dromide, 1-octadecyl bromide, etc. In addition, the efficiency of other modifications into SA emulsions for antibacterial polymer cement waterproof coatings could be studied as well.

Practical implications

The method provided a practical solution for the improvement of water-based antibacterial acrylate polymer cement waterproof coatings.

Originality/value

The method for enhancing bacteria resistance and mechanical properties of the waterproof coating was novel and valuable.
